A man has gone missing from his home at Thorpe-le-Soken in Essex and police are appealing for help to trace him.

Father-of-three Peter Mills, 47, was last seen on Friday afternoon when he drove off in his white Mitsubishi Pajero car.

There was a possible sighting of the car near Stansted airport at about 10pm but no further reports of the vehicle being seen.

Inspector Terry Jacobs, who is leading the search, said: “We are extremely concerned for Mr Mills’ welfare as it is completely out of character to go missing in this way.”

Mr Mills is 5ft 11in tall, of large build and has greying short hair. When last seen he was wearing a distinctive bright orange top, black jogging bottoms and blue and white trainers.

Officers want to hear from anyone with information about Mr Mills, or who has seen his 4x4 car with the index N278NCW.
